Molly Qerim’s Net Worth and Career After ESPN Exit

With Molly Qerim leaving ESPN’s First Take, fans are revisiting her decade-long run and the impressive fortune she built in sports media. Reports estimate her net worth in 2025 at $3–4 million, driven by salary, endorsements, and strategic career moves.

From Local Sports to National Spotlight

A Connecticut native, Qerim studied at UConn and Quinnipiac before landing early roles at CBS Sports Network and NFL Network. In 2015, she joined ESPN, becoming the steady presence on First Take and guiding high-profile debates with Stephen A. Smith.

Salary and Benefits

By 2025, Qerim reportedly earned between $500,000 and $600,000 annually, with some sources claiming her latest deal pushed closer to $1.5 million. Perks included health coverage, wardrobe services, travel benefits, and bonuses—making her one of the highest-paid women in sports broadcasting.

Beyond the Desk

Her income expanded with Nike and Adidas endorsements, paid appearances, and speaking engagements. Off-camera, Qerim is recognized for philanthropy, supporting education, women’s empowerment, and organizations like Boys & Girls Clubs of America.

Her departure leaves questions about what’s next, but her financial and professional legacy is firmly secure.
